Sudan Crisis Deepens as Aid Agencies Warn of Worsening Hunger

WHO and WFP say nearly 34 million people need help as war strains health care, food access and displacement response

LONDON | Sudan’s humanitarian crisis is deepening as the country enters another year of war, with aid agencies warning that hunger, displacement, disease and attacks on health care are combining into one of the world’s most severe emergencies.

What This Means

Sudan matters because the scale of suffering is enormous and still growing. Nearly two out of every three people in the country need humanitarian support, while famine risk, disease and displacement continue to worsen under the pressure of war.
